For purposes of this chapter, the following definitions shall be ascribed to the terms set forth herein and shall govern the application and interpretation of this chapter unless the context clearly indicates or requires a different meaning.
"Demonstrated management competency"means the experience, competency, capability, and capacity of the proposed management staffing to complete projects of similar size, scope, or complexity.
"Design-build contract"means a contract between the city and a design-build entity to furnish the following for a public works project: (1) the architectural, engineering and other related services necessary to fully design the public works project; and (2) the labor, materials, equipment, project management and other related services necessary to construct the public works project.
"Design-build entity"means the entity, whether a natural person, partnership, limited partnership, joint venture, corporation, professional corporation, business association or other legal entity, that provides appropriately licensed contracting, architectural, and engineering services as needed to perform the design-build contract.
"Director"means the director of the city department primarily responsible for awarding, managing and administering a design-build contract pursuant to the provisions of this chapter or such other person designated by the city administrator.
"Financial condition"mean the financial resources needed to perform the design-build contract. The criteria used to evaluate a proposer's financial condition shall include, at a minimum, current financial statements and bonding capacity, capacity to obtain all required payment bonds, performance bonds, and liability insurance.
"Qualifications"means the financial condition, relevant experience, including completion of projects on time and within budget, demonstrated management competency, the safety record of the proposer, and, if required by the proposal documents, some or all of the preceding qualifications as to subcontractors or design professionals proposed to be used by the design-build entity for designated portions of the work.
